What triggers the Shopify appeal timeline
The appeal timeline starts when one of three things happens:
1. You receive a suspension email from Trust and Safety, Merchant Trust, or Risk Operations.
2. Your Shopify Payments dashboard shows a hold banner that explicitly invites you to submit an appeal
or documentation.
3. You proactively appeal an extended hold or reserve before receiving a formal denial.
The clock that matters isn’t when you first email — it’s when Shopify logs your appeal in their internal queue. Those are often different by 2-5 business days.

What slows down a Shopify appeal timeline
Even on the direct path, certain factors will extend the timeline. Watch for these:
Multiple cases against one Shopify ID — If you have two stores under the same merchant account, both
need to clear.
Cross-platform cases — Klarna and Shopify cases that overlap take 5-10 extra days because both teams
need to align.
Active chargebacks during appeal — New chargebacks reset some of the risk math.
Incomplete documentation — Missing supplier agreements, missing fulfillment proof, missing customer
correspondence.
Recent volume spikes — If you’re processing through Stripe or PayPal during the appeal, sudden new
volume can extend the review.
Pending litigation or BBB complaints — These trigger automatic escalation to Legal, which adds 14+
days.

What to do while waiting on a Shopify appeal
Whichever path you’re on, the actions during the appeal matter:
1. Don’t open duplicate tickets. Each new ticket can reset your queue position.
2. Don’t change business details mid-appeal. New bank account, new business name, new address all
trigger re-verification.
3. Keep fulfillment current. Outstanding orders during an appeal are a strong negative signal.
4. Respond to documentation requests within 24 hours. Slow response is the single biggest avoidable
extension factor.
5. Don’t engage Shopify legal until prompted. Mentioning lawyers early triggers automatic legal queue,
which adds weeks.
6. Screenshot everything. Every banner, every email, every chat. You’ll need it.

Frequently asked questions
How long is the Shopify appeal timeline on average? The public path averages 60-90 days end to end. The direct Risk Operations path averages 14-21 days. Both timelines depend on case complexity, documentation completeness, and current queue load.
How long does the Shopify Trust and Safety queue take? The Trust and Safety queue typically delivers a first response in 7-14 days and a first decision in 30-60 days. Second-level appeals add another 30-60 days on top. The queue is shared globally across all cases.
Can I speed up a Shopify appeal timeline? The public path is largely fixed by queue position. The only way to genuinely shorten a Shopify appeal timeline is to escalate through direct Risk Operations contacts, which is what services like Unholdr do.
What’s the longest a Shopify appeal can take? Account-level terminations and banking-partner unsupportable cases can take 6 months or more on the public path. The direct path caps these at around 30-45 days.
Does the Shopify appeal timeline pause if I don’t respond? Yes. If Risk Ops asks for documentation and you take 5 days to respond, the timeline pauses for 5 days. Slow merchant response is the single largest avoidable cause of extended Shopify appeal timelines.
What happens if my Shopify appeal is denied?
On the public path, you can submit a second-level appeal within 30 days, but win rates on second appeals are below 15%. On the direct path, a denial means the case profile genuinely doesn’t qualify and a different strategy (alternative processors, business restructure) becomes the priority.
